RCAG introduces “Art Talk”, which will take students on a comprehensive tour of the history, architecture, and management of 401 Richmond. This arts-and-culture hub is home to over 140 artists, cultural producers, social innovators, microenterprises, galleries, festivals, and shops.
The tour will be followed by two rounds of panel discussions with representatives from the galleries and open networking. The panel will be an in-depth discussion of life as a creative, tips and advice for working in a creative industry, and the rep’s personal journey in their artistic endeavours and work field.
